Homemade blends that can reduce monsoon fatigue


As much as we wait for the rainy season for the respite from scorching heat, this much awaited season also brings with it a wave of ailments and infections that often leave us feeling drained, drowsy and sluggish. Then you need to read on and try out these healthy drinks that can be made at home too without putting in much efforts.

2/7

Why monsoon fatigue?


Most people feel that monsoon fatigue and lethargy are induced only because of the gloomy weather, but little do we know that these symptoms may be linked to other factors like reduced sunlight, low activity levels, decreased activity levels, season borne ailments to name a few. An easy way to reverse the fatigue caused by season is by simply adding detoxifying blends to the daily diet and how these

potent homemade blends that can naturally help in improving immunity and building resistance to combat allergies and infections. Here are some drinks that can be added to the daily diet.

3/7

Lemon Water

Starting your day with warm lemon water is a simple yet effective detox drink. The citric acid in lemons aids digestion and stimulates the liver to flush out toxins. Just squeeze half a lemon into a glass of warm water along with a dash black salt and black pepper powder and honey, this drink can be consumed on an empty stomach and can help flush out toxins and will boost energy levels by reducing the mucus build up, which is one the causes of fatigue in this season.

4/7

Fennel Green Tea


Packed with antioxidants, green tea made with fennel seeds is a powerful detox drink. It supports liver function and boosts metabolism, helping to eliminate toxins from the body. Enjoy it hot or iced, and consider adding a slice of lemon for an extra detox boost.

5/7

Beetroot Juice


Beetroot is known for its detoxifying properties, especially for the liver. Juicing beets can provide a concentrated source of nutrients. Mix beet juice with carrots and apples for a deliciously sweet and earthy detox drink.

6/7

Ginger Turmeric Tea

Both ginger and turmeric are powerful anti-inflammatory ingredients that can aid in detoxification. Boil fresh ginger and turmeric in water, then strain and add a bit of honey or lemon for flavor. This warm drink can soothe digestion and enhance your overall wellness.

7/7

Apple Cider Vinegar Tonic

Apple cider vinegar is renowned for its health benefits, including promoting digestion and regulating blood sugar levels. Mix one to two tablespoons of raw, unfiltered apple cider vinegar with a glass of water, soaked cinnamon, a drizzle of honey, and a sprinkle of cinnamon for a tasty tonic.
